Being on a real touristy tour means we’re hitting all the classic touristy stuff, and they’re touristy for a reason – ’cause obviously they’re the most famous historical sites in China. Today was Tiananmen Square and the Forbidden City. I don’t really know what constitutes a “square” but Tiananmen claims to be the biggest in the world. Here are a cupla shots both during the day and at night.

The tanks rolled in to the square just off to the left of the picture on the right. The fate of the citizen who stood in front of the tanks is unknown. He might very well be languishing in some miserable prison right now, unaware of his influence on history. Scary.

To enter the Forbidden City, you pass under the famous portrait of Chairman Mao. I’m writing this a few days later and so far my favorite thing is watching the people and the behaviors (for example, walking through the old town of Chongqing was my favorite so far). Still, the Forbidden City was quite impressive. I’m not sure how to describe the size, far bigger than I was expecting, mostly consisting of huge plazas surrounded by ornate buildings. The thing was that we passed through many of these gates to different sections. Most of the sections are quite wide open but we did get to some cozy residential areas for the emperor and his various concubines.

Unfortunately, some of the structures were covered in scaffolding, getting ready for the 2008 Olympics.

In the evening, after coming back from Tiananmen Square, we hit this night market for food. Lots of quality chow was available, freaky things like centipedes on a stick. I got some of these nice fried banana fritter things:
